Question 1 of 5

The nurse would prepare to screen clients for gestational diabetes at which time during the pregnancy?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: The glucose challenge test for gestational diabetes is typically done between 24 and 28 weeks of gestation, when insulin resistance increases, making it the optimal screening time.

Extract:

A nurse is completing the admission assessment of a client who is at 38 weeks of gestation and has severe preeclampsia.


Question 3 of 5

Which of the following is an expected finding?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: A headache is a common symptom of severe preeclampsia due to cerebral hypertension. Clonus is present, not absent, and oliguria, not polyuria, is typical.
